There are lots of road biking options in Glenwood. “Most Popular” doesn’t always mean best, but it does mean these are the trails people are biking a lot. Here are 5 of the most popular road biking options in Glenwood Springs:
1. Glenwood Canyon Trail

Glenwood Canyon Trail along I70 and the Colorado River
The Glenwood Canyon Trail is a wonderful wide paved path through Glenwood Canyon with cliff walls and the Colorado River winding around this beautiful stretch below Interstate 70.
2. Rio Grande Trail

The Rio Grande Trail from Aspen to Glenwood
The Rio Grande Trail is a nice wide paved path following the once Denver & Rio Grande Railroad route that you can run for miles along, all the way to Aspen.
3. Four Mile Road (CR 117)
Four Mile Road is a beautiful escape into the forest that leads to Sunlight Mountain.
4. Spring Valley Loop
The Spring Valley Loop, ridden clockwise or counter clock wise, combines a ride through Red Canyon and Colorado Mountain College Spring Valley Campus back to Highway 82 and the Rio Grande Trail.
5. Hardwick Bridge Road (CR 109)
Hardwick Bridge Road is a paved backroad off the old Highway 82 through the Ironbridge community all the way to Carbondale. You can use the Rio Grande Trail to complete a loop.
